Mesabi East School On behalf of Minnesota Power, Laskin Energy Center Relief Operator Joe Dahmen presented a plaque to Mesabi East athletic director Jim James and math teacher and assistant golf coach Mike McNulty for working with the Company to promote the benefits of energy-saving lighting.

MP also presented a $700 check earned by students in the Company-sponsored “Learn & Earn” program, which features school- and-community-based projects to promote energy-efficient lighting. The program also raises students’ and residents’ awareness of the economic and environmental benefits of replacing incandescent light bulbs, lamps and fixtures with ENERGY STAR®-qualifying compact fluorescent light bulbs, lighting fixtures and lamps. Customers receive instant rebates and store discounts when they purchase ENERGY STAR®-qualified products.

Schools can earn between $1 and $5 per qualifying product (up to a total of $5,000) sold at designated retailers to support school programs, purchase school equipment, or to help raise funds for selected school events. Funds raised will benefit the Mesabi East School boys’ and girls’ golf program.

James, McNulty and the school’s golf team members helped promote the lighting products by distributing flyers and posters to businesses in Hoyt Lakes, Aurora and Biwabik.

Minnesota Power and the City of Biwabik Utility, the Learn & Earn co-sponsors for Mesabi East’s program, appreciate the enthusiastic work by students and faculty, as well as commitment from retailers Bradach Lumber and Bradach Ace Hardware Stores, to promote the benefits of energy-saving lighting.
